Hearty Cottage Cheese Breakfast Biscuits

Hearty Cottage Cheese Breakfast Biscuits for Busy Mornings

Hearty Cottage Cheese Breakfast Biscuits make for a delicious, protein-packed start to your busy mornings.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 25 minutes
Total Time 40 minutes
Course Breakfast
Cuisine American
Servings 12 biscuits
Calories 220 kcal

Equipment

  • Oven
  • Mixing bowl
  • Baking sheet
  • Parchment paper
  • Whisk
  • Measuring cups
  • Measuring spoons

Ingredients
  

For the Biscuits

  • 2.6 cups flour sifted all-purpose flour recommended
  • 1/4 cup flaxseed can be omitted
  • 1 tsp garlic powder can substitute with fresh garlic
  • 3/4 tsp red pepper flakes adjust to taste
  • 1 tsp black pepper
  • 1 tbsp baking powder check for freshness
  • 1 tsp salt
  • 1 cup Greek yogurt full-fat recommended
  • 2 large eggs

For the Add-Ins

  • 1.5 cups spinach, chopped fresh or frozen works
  • 1/2 cup chives, finely chopped green onions can substitute
  • 1.5 cups cheddar cheese, shredded can swap with Monterey Jack
  • 2 cups ham, diced any cooked meat can substitute
  • 1/2 cup sun-dried tomatoes, chopped omit if not available
  • 2 cups chicken sausage, cooked and crumbled can omit or replace with vegetarian options
  • 1.5 cups feta cheese, crumbled goat cheese is an alternative
  • 2 tsp basil, dried or fresh can be omitted

Instructions
 

Preparation

  • Preheat the oven to 400°F (200°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
  • Chop the spinach, chives, sun-dried tomatoes, and ham. Crumble the feta.
  • Whisk together the Greek yogurt and eggs in a large bowl until smooth.
  • In a separate bowl, combine flour, flaxseed, garlic powder, red pepper flakes, black pepper, baking powder, and salt.
  • Combine the dry mixture with the wet ingredients, folding gently until just mixed.
  • Fold in the spinach, chives, sun-dried tomatoes, ham, sausage, cheeses, and basil.
  • Lightly flour your hands and divide the thick dough into 12 portions, forming them into thick disks.
  • Arrange the biscuits on the prepared baking sheet, leaving about 2 inches between each one.
  • Bake the biscuits for 5 minutes at 400°F, then reduce the temperature to 350°F and bake for an additional 20 minutes.
  • Cool briefly on the baking sheet before transferring the biscuits to a wire rack.
